Read the excerpt from Fast Food Nation The strict regimentation at fast food restaurants creates standardized products. It increases the throughput.
And it gives fast food companies an enormous amount of power over their employees. "When management
determines exactly how every task is to be done ... and can impose its own rules about pace, output, quality,
and technique," the sociologist Robin Leidner has noted, “[it] makes workers increasingly interchangeable."
The management no longer depends upon the talents or skills of its workers—those things are built into the
operating system and machines.
